Save For Later

Exploring Flask

Save For Later

Want to turn your Python programs into web sites and apps? Flask is the little framework that can. With a low barrier to entry, tons of handy packages, and a fast start up, Flask is the go to web framework for many Python developers.By the end of the track, you'll know the basics of Python, how to install and start using Flask, how to use a database with Python and your Flask app, and more.

OpenCourser is an affiliate partner of Treehouse and may earn a commission when you buy through our links.

From Treehouse
Hours 19
Instructors Treasure Porth, Chris Ramacciotti, Kenneth Love, Ashley Boucher
Language English
Subjects Programming

Similar Courses

Sorted by relevance


An overview of related careers and their average salaries in the US. Bars indicate income percentile (33rd - 99th).

Developer (PHP or Python) $64k

Pragmatic Python Charmer $74k

Python Risk Developer $90k

Python Automation Developer $90k

Programmer (Python) $99k

Training (Python) $104k

Java Python Developer $107k

PHP or Python Developer $119k

Python Developer Lead $122k

Python Software Developer $127k

Python / Django Developer $127k

Python / Risk Developer $136k

Courses in this Track

Listed in the order in which they should be taken

Starts Course Information

On Demand

Introduction to HTML and CSS

Get started creating web pages with HTML and CSS, the basic building blocks of web development. HTML, or HyperText Markup Language, is a standard set of tags you will use to tell...



On Demand

Introducing Tuples

Learn about a python data structures that's similar to lists, but with one key difference. What you'll learnTuplesSegments in this Workshop



On Demand

HTTP Basics

During this course, we'll take a look at the underlying method that devices use to communicate with each other: HTTP, or the HyperText Transfer Protocol. In particular, we'll...



On Demand

Introducing Dictionaries

Another useful Python data structure is the dictionary. Learn how to write one and use one in your day to day Python code.What you'll learn**kwargs Writing dictionaries Key:value...



On Demand

Flask Basics

Flask is one of the easiest ways to bring your Python skills online. It's a great microframework used by thousands of people to create prototypes and small web apps.What you'll...



On Demand

Python Sequences

Discover several types of Python sequences, many ways of sequence iterations, and all of the common sequence operations.What you'll learnFor loops Slicing Ranges Sequence...



On Demand

Functions, Packing, and Unpacking

Learn the ins and outs of Python functions, how to send and receive values to functions, and all about Python packing and unpacking.What you'll learnFunction definition Arguments...



On Demand

Using Databases in Python

When you want to store data from a program, you have two general choices: files or databases. In this course, we're going to explore using a database from within Python by using...



On Demand

Build a Social Network with Flask

It's time to dig in and build something big. In this course, we're going to take the tools we've learned, Flask, Peewee, and Python itself, and build a small social network. We'll...



On Demand


Many of the APIs you'll encounter on the Web use an underlying design idea known as REST, which stands for Representational State Transfer. Understanding what and how aWhat you'll...



On Demand

Flask REST API (You were viewing this course)

Building an API with Flask can be pretty simple but you'll often end up with a large amount of code in just one or two files. In other words, it can be messy. But with a few...




From Treehouse
Hours 19
Instructors Treasure Porth, Chris Ramacciotti, Kenneth Love, Ashley Boucher
Language English
Subjects Programming


An overview of related careers and their average salaries in the US. Bars indicate income percentile (33rd - 99th).

Developer (PHP or Python) $64k

Pragmatic Python Charmer $74k

Python Risk Developer $90k

Python Automation Developer $90k

Programmer (Python) $99k

Training (Python) $104k

Java Python Developer $107k

PHP or Python Developer $119k

Python Developer Lead $122k

Python Software Developer $127k

Python / Django Developer $127k

Python / Risk Developer $136k

Similar Courses

Sorted by relevance